SUTTON, England, November 7 /PRNewswire/ -- Hairdressers Journal International (HJ) first published 125 years ago and has been the essential weekly read for the hairdressing profession ever since. It has gone through decades offering its readers exclusive hair fashion, essential business information, professional advice, product news and celebrity style information - all the information a serious professional has needed to succeed. On the 23rd November 2007 HJ will publish a special supplement to mark its 125th anniversary and it will take you through time with the images from each decade, news reviews and product information.
